Employ the Newton-Raphson method to determine a real root for f (x) = −2 + 6x − 4x2 + 0.5x3, using an initial guess of 

(a) 4.5,

(b) 4.43. Discuss and use graphical and analytical methods to explain any peculiarities in your results.
